Understanding the psychological tricks that keep gamblers coming back
The unpredictability of rewards is a powerful psychological driver in gambling. This phenomenon, often termed the «variable ratio reinforcement schedule,» suggests that the uncertain nature of winning keeps players engaged. Gamblers never know when a win might occur, and this uncertainty can create a thrill that keeps them returning for more, as each session holds the potential for a rewarding surprise.
